Minotaur put through countdown rehearsal

The service structure at the Kodiak Launch Complex retracted away from the Minotaur 4 rocket Monday, exposing the booster during a simulated countdown to practice procedures for Friday's scheduled liftoff with seven small satellites for the U.S. Air Force, NASA and university students.
